SB 1110·MI·senate

Health: licensing; name requirements for licensure; provide for. Amends sec. 16177 of 1978 PA 368 (MCL 333.16177).

In CommitteeFiled Jul 15, 2026
Sponsor: Jeremy Moss (D)
Latest Action

REFERRED TO COMMITTEE ON REGULATORY AFFAIRS

Jul 15, 2026

Summary

The bill modifies the existing licensing statute (MCL 333.16177) to update the name requirements for obtaining a health‑related license. It would affect individuals applying for or renewing health professional licenses by altering how names must be presented. The change is intended to improve accuracy and consistency in the licensing process.
